
a fledgling IS a bird...

I agree. Maybe some native speaker could clarify this situation.

Google is our friend.
'fledgling' is also an adjective ('one who is fledging'). This is a somewhat redundant phrase, sure, but that's what you have in English.
(cf. 'baby' as a noun and an adjective)
